Binchester Roman Fort
Binchester Fort is situated in the centre of County Durham, just outside of the town of Bishop Auckland. Binchester was the largest Roman fort in County Durham. A small part has been excavated and is open to view. Most of the fort and the remains of the nearby civilian settlement still lie buried in the surrounding fields.

Raby Castle
One of the England's most impressive Mediaeval castles, Raby was built by the Nevills and has been home to Lord Barnard's family since 1626. It features fine furniture, impressive artworks and elaborate architecture. Visitors can also enjoy the deer park, large walled gardens, coach and carriage collection, woodland adventure playground, picnic area, tearooms and gift shop.

The Monkey Sanctuary
The Monkey Sanctuary in Cornwall has been the home to a colony of woolly monkeys since 1964. Its original aim was to provide a stable setting in which woolly monkeys, rescued from lives of isolation in zoos or as pets, could live as naturally as possible. The Sanctuary has received world-wide recognition as the first place where this beautiful primate has survived and bred successfully in captivity. Our aim is to secure a protected reserve in the Amazon for monkeys from the pet trade and if possible also to rehabilitate some of the Cornish group.

Goonhilly Earth Station
Goonhilly Earth Station is the largest Satellite Earth Station in the World. In the last 38 years it has probably transmitted & received more remarkable events than any other Satellite Earth Station, from the Apollo 11 moon landing in 1969 to pictures from the Olympic Games in Atlanta, USA in 1996.

Lynton & Barnstaple Railway
Located in the South West of England, The Lynton and Barnstaple Railway was opened in 1898 and closed in 1935. Built to a track gauge of 1ft 11½in, it ran for a distance of 19½ miles linking the two North Devon towns from which it takes its name. The present Lynton & Barnstaple Railway Company was formed in 1993 by the members of the Lynton & Barnstaple Railway Association, now a Trust, with the aim of reconstructing as much as possible of this once famous narrow gauge railway.

West Somerset Railway
Twenty miles of stunning Somerset countryside and coastal scenery - there's something for all the family on Britain's longest and most lovingly restored heritage railway. Our charming line runs from Bishops Lydeard, near Taunton, past the Quantock Hills northwards towards the Bristol Channel coast at Minehead, serving ten beautifully restored stations along the way.
